Quick Assessment
This early reader book introduces young children to the fascinating world of ants through simple text and engaging illustrations. It covers ant anatomy, behavior, colony life, and interesting facts suitable for ages 5-8. Parents can expect educational content that encourages curiosity about nature without any intense or concerning themes.
